钢-混凝土组合梁与钢筋混凝土柱连接节点的试验研究

Experimental research on joint between steel-concrete composite beam and reinforced concrete column

摘要 依托实际工程,通过两个钢-混凝土组合梁与钢筋混凝土柱连接节点的缩尺模型试验,提出了以对拉钢筋代替钢梁翼缘穿过节点核心区的梁柱节点做法。试验证明,此类节点构造合理,传力可靠,施工方便,具有良好的承载能力和抗震性能。在试验研究基础上,提出了节点的抗剪承载力及构造措施,为该类节点的设计与施工提供参考。 Based on a real case,design concept and constructional details of the joints between steel-concrete composite beam and reinforced concrete column were introduced through the experiment of two models,in which steel beam flanges were substituted with reinforcement in the case design of a conference building.The test results indicate that the joint is comparatively safe and rational.Shear capacity and construction methods are also advanced which provide reference for the project design and construction.
